Fork me on GitHub

为什么查看帖子都是显示到最后回复的那个人?

edited 2013年03月09日 问答求助

比如这个 http://vanillaforums.cn/discussion/470/为什么自己发的帖子被人回复了不显示黄色的提示#latest

只要后面有#latest是不是别人第一次打开都是跑到最后一个回复人的页面而不是主题发布人的内容?假如这个帖子有十几页,那不是跑到最后了吗?为什么不是显示主题发布人的内容?能取消#latest这个吗?

回复

  • 为什么我就不解释了

    去掉这个特性是可以的,在config.php中加上配置项
    $Configuration['Vanilla']['Comments']['AutoOffset'] = false;

  • @chuck911 是程序默认就这样的吗?

  • @qq123456 嗯,默认情况下登录用户打开帖子页面是跳到末尾的,未登录不会

  • @chuck911 加了$Configuration['Vanilla']['Comments']['AutoOffset'] = false; 登入后还是会跳到最后

  • @qq123456 我这里测试是有用的,你看看是不是被另一句覆盖了? 有加在最下面吗

  • @chuck911
    // Vanilla
    $Configuration['Vanilla']['Version'] = '2.1a33';
    $Configuration['Vanilla']['Discussions']['PerPage'] = '30';
    $Configuration['Vanilla']['Comments']['AutoRefresh'] = NULL;
    $Configuration['Vanilla']['Comments']['PerPage'] = '30';
    $Configuration['Vanilla']['Archive']['Date'] = '';
    $Configuration['Vanilla']['Archive']['Exclude'] = FALSE;
    $Configuration['Vanilla']['AdminCheckboxes']['Use'] = FALSE;

    $Configuration['Vanilla']['Comments']['AutoOffset'] = FALSE;

    是加到最下面了。。。

  • 那$Configuration['Vanilla']['Comments']['AutoOffset'] = ture;是啥意思啊?

  • @qq123456 true就是自动跳转到末尾啊,默认就是true

  • edited 2013年03月14日 #9

    那你看看我这些添加的应该没问题嘛?为什么还是跳到末尾?我真郁闷死了

登录注册 才能回复。